Welcome to Carnen, a fully decorated neighborhood, using many of Criquettes excellent decorations. You do not need to download all of Criquette's sets if you don't want to, but it has been designed to use the road pieces that came with the decorative road pieces set. Which means that if you do not have this set there will be many roads that end abruptly.

Carnen comes with two areas where you can build beach lots, a large main street and residential area. There are also a couple of other areas outside of town where you can build houses.

As a decorated neighborhood can't be packaged you need to download the custom content yourself. The neighborhood will work if you do not download everything. Please remember to place the cc into the downloads folder before you start the game, as the cc will not appear if you add them after you have opened the neighborhood once.

To install Carnen, open the .rar file and move the folder named N155 to your EA Games\The Sims 2\Neighborhoods folder. You'll find them in your "My documents" folder. (Or "Documents" if you've got Vista. Sooo efficient .) If you just want the terrain with no decor, the .sc4 file is included in the same .rar. Just move it to EA Games\The Sims 2\SC4Terrains and make a new neighborhood the usual way. You do not need the .sc4 terrain to use the decorated 'hood.
